If (3) complete revolutions are made, what is the total angle?

Advertisement

Answer and explanation

Correct answer: \(1080^\circ\)

One complete revolution equals \(360^\circ\). Therefore, the angle for 3 complete revolutions is \(3\times360^\circ=1080^\circ\). \(720^\circ\) represents only 2 complete revolutions. Exam tip: multiply the number of complete revolutions by \(360^\circ\) to convert them into degrees.
